当在构建 React Native 应用时,可能会遇到此错误,该错误通常表示您正在使用未知的数据类型。这通常是因为您可能没有将该数据类型导入到您的代码中,或者您...
AWS Amplify是一种用于Web和移动应用程序的JavaScript库,可简化开发人员将应用程序连接到Amazon Web Services的过程。Cog...
这个问题通常是因为缺少身份验证令牌或令牌已过期而导致的。要解决这个问题,可以通过以下方式进行身份验证:在代码中获取身份验证令牌,并将其添加到 graphql 查...
在 GraphQL subscription 中添加过滤器:import { onCreateTodo } from './graphql/subscripti...
在AWS Amplify中设置GraphQL的数据订阅过程可能会有一定的困难。以下是一些可能的解决方案:确保您的订阅查询在其operation字段中有subsc...
我们可以使用DynamoDB的权限级别和过滤器功能来限制查询返回结果以仅包含自己的数据。在GraphQL schema中,我们可以添加自定义的查询类型,例如:t...
这可能是缓存“对象不变性”的结果。解决方法是使用update函数手动更新状态,并使用update函数来强制更新组件。以下是一个示例:import { graph...
在AWS Amplify中,使用Graphql Mutations进行数据库操作时,可能需要在删除一个原始项目时,同时删除与其相关联的表项。本文介绍一个解决方法...
此错误通常是由于后端返回了未定义的 createdAt 字段而导致的。可以使用 @connection 和 @key 指令来解决此问题。首先,我们在数据模型中添...
在AWS Amplify GraphQL中,创建一个新的User表是否必须与您的应用程序需求有关。如果您的应用程序需要帐户管理,那么创建一个User表就是必要的...
这个错误通常表示您在需要非空ID的位置上提供了null值,可能是由于代码中的逻辑错误或处理错误的情况导致的。为了解决这个问题,您需要在某些情况下检查是否存在nu...
在AppSync中,可以通过设置 @model 指令中的 @searchable 参数来控制是否返回已删除的项目。要禁止返回已删除的项目,只需将 @search...
使用API的公共访问设置要使用AWS Amplify Graph API的公共访问设置,可以按照以下步骤操作。Step 1:在AWS Amplify的AWS M...
这个问题通常发生在使用AWS Amplify时更新堆栈时。如果您在堆栈更新期间遇到了错误,该堆栈将保持在“更新中”状态并且可能无法正确完成。下面是一些可能解决问...
在使用AWS Amplify构建应用程序时,有时会遇到“StackUpdateComplete”错误。这种错误通常发生在AWS Amplify与AWS Clou...
如果 AWS Amplify 构建失败,可能是因为以下原因之一:创建的 AWS Amplify App 绑定的 Git 库(比如 Github)中缺少必要的文件...
可能出现构建失败而没有错误日志的情况是由于缺少环境变量或配置文件中存在错误。您可以尝试通过以下步骤来解决这个问题:检查您的AWS Amplify应用环境变量是否...
在package.json文件中使用npm ci命令之前,将node_modules目录删除并运行npm install命令。示例代码:删除node_modul...
这个问题通常是在使用AWS Amplify构建SSR(Server-Side Rendering服务端渲染)应用程序时出现的,它不支持基本身份验证。要解决这个问...
这个错误通常是由于编译器卡住了AWS Amplify的构建进程造成的。为了解决它,您可以尝试以下步骤:检查您的文件大小以及依赖关系。确保您的文件尽可能小且互相独...